Serax is a Belgian design label with a broad portfolio of tableware, pottery, design furniture, lighting, and accessories. Throughout its 30-year history, the company has been growing steadily.

“Our recent expansion has been mostly organic, driven by our 5-year growth plan”, explains Ragna Qvick, Digital Business Manager at Serax. “We have sales hubs in multiple countries in Europe. And two years ago, we opened a new entity with its own warehouse in the US. At the same time, we’re continuously expanding our product range and attracting new designers.”

From SAP Business One…

To manage their operations and supply chain, Serax was using the SME-focused SAP Business One platform since 2005. “But we were reaching the limits of the system”, says Ragna. “As we had developed a lot of custom functionalities over the years, new updates were becoming very complex. Moreover, the US entity worked with its own ERP which was not integrated with ours. If we wanted to support our growth, we needed one centralized system and database.”

Serax was also hosting SAP Business One on an external server. “This proved to be quite cumbersome”, says Sara Goris, IT Product Manager at Serax. “Users had to log in with a VPN, and we had no integrated digital workplace. To make our system fully futureproof, we decided to move to a cloud-based solution.

… to SAP S/4HANA Public Cloud

After researching possible tools, Serax decided that SAP S/4HANA was the way to go. “In fact, our original idea was to implement a Warehouse Management System (WMS) to get a better view of our stock”, Ragna explains. “But integrating a WMS with SAP Business One would have been costly and complicated, while S/4HANA includes a WMS.”

When defining the scope, we realized S/4HANA would offer much more benefits: a shared platform with the US entity, the digital supply chain, continuous upgrades and optimizations and integration with our existing tools.

Integration requirements


Together with Flexso, Serax determined the scope and roadmap for the implementation:

  • Reviewing the business processes
    Review and adapt the way of working to the S/4HANA best practices.
  • Integration with other tools
    Including a new B2B platform, customs applications and Garvis, which adds AI-capabilities to the forecasting.
  • Improve business intelligence
    Implementing SAP Analytics Cloud for real-time operational reporting and insights.

The results

One of the big challenges was the master data integration. “This is a complex task, but it’s absolutely crucial for a successful implementation”, confirms Ragna. “We not only embedded SAP Analytics Cloud, but we also gathered data from several external sources into one central database. All these data sources are now centrally managed in S/4HANA.”

The biggest challenge during the implementation? “The fact that our own users weren’t sufficiently available”, says Ragna. We had to stay operational, and we didn’t have enough time to support the implementation. This had some impact on timing, but with a lot of hard work, good project management and great teamwork from both our colleagues and the Flexso team, we made it work.”

Life after go-live

The go-live was a success. “Our operations in Belgium and USA were up and running from day one”, says Sara. “Invoicing happened in a controlled way in the first few days after go-live and we kept a very close look on the integrations. After one week it was clear that the daily business could continue as before. We had no business disruption whatsoever. Of course, all internal and external stakeholders needed some time to adapt to the new way of working.”

The results are just as impressive. “We have a much better view on planning and forecasting”, says Sara. “The stock control and order delivery are much more efficient. Our departments are now all working with the same data as well. Our customer service, for instance, has a clear view on stock, planning, rescheduling and reallocation. They can create priorities based on customer segmentation.”

From static to real-time analytics

Another challenge for Serax was the operational reporting. “S/4HANA Cloud has an embedded operational reporting tool with real-time data that covered a lot of our reporting needs”, says Ragna, “To combine those insights with financial and strategic reporting, we implemented SAP Analytics Cloud, which has an out-of-the-box integration with S/4HANA.”

The first concrete use case is the financial group reporting, integrated with the S/4HANA finance module. This enables faster financial close and more insights in the financial results. For now, Serax is working on a unified way of reporting, but in the future key users will be trained to create reports for their specific business domains.
